Individual, long-term volunteers are invited to help out at one of our community centers, senior centers, or with our recreation programming.
All prospective individual volunteers must complete a registration form, a workers compensation form, and a record check form. Record checks take approximately two weeks. Once the record check is approved, we will work to place you in your chosen setting, or in a setting best-suited to your needs and talents. Volunteer Position
Youth Sports Coach
Position description: The roles of the coaches could be as an assistant or head coach, determined by the community center site. Youth Leagues that may need such volunteers would include: Youth Flag Football, Youth Basketball, Youth Girls Softball, T-Ball & Youth Baseball, and Youth Soccer. These are unpaid positions. Coaches are responsible for there own transportation to and from various game site locations. Various game times and sites will depend on the sport and the availability of the park field and community center locations.
